Overview of Sant Benet De Bages Monastery

Nestled just outside Barcelona, the Sant Benet de Bages monastery stands as a remarkable testament to Catalonia’s rich history. Founded over a thousand years ago, this serene site showcases stunning architecture and lush natural surroundings.
Originally a Benedictine monastery, it offers visitors insight into the lives of monks and the region’s spiritual heritage. The intricate cloister and ancient church reveal the craftsmanship of the past, while the wine cellar hints at the monastery’s agricultural roots.
With modern additions like a culinary research center, Sant Benet seamlessly blends history and contemporary culture, inviting exploration and reflection for all who visit.

Exploring the Monastery’s Historical Significance
While many might focus on the beauty of Sant Benet de Bages monastery, its historical significance is equally compelling. Founded over a thousand years ago, this site reflects the profound influence of monastic life on Catalonian culture.
The monastery served as a spiritual center, fostering education, agriculture, and community development. Visitors can explore the intricately designed cloister and the ancient wine cellar, which tell stories of past monks who lived there.
The site also showcases architectural styles that evolved over centuries, making it a unique testament to the region’s rich history and a vital link to understanding Catalonia’s medieval heritage.
